Main Features and Functionalities

The Fibaro Smart Implant boasts several key features that enhance its utility within a smart home ecosystem. Understanding these functionalities is crucial for homeowners who want to make the most out of their smart technology investments.

– Two Digital Inputs: The Smart Implant can connect to two separate devices, allowing users to control various functions, such as switching lights on and off or managing security systems.
– Two Relay Outputs: It includes two relay outputs that enable the control of high-voltage devices like motors and fans, offering robust automation possibilities.
– Compatibility with Z-Wave Protocol: The device utilizes the Z-Wave wireless communication protocol, ensuring compatibility with a wide array of other smart home devices, creating a more integrated environment.
– Temperature Sensor Integration: The Smart Implant can be paired with temperature sensors, enabling automated climate control based on real-time data.

Installation Process in a Home Environment

Installing the Fibaro Smart Implant requires careful consideration to ensure it functions effectively within the home. The installation process involves several steps that allow homeowners to set up the device with minimal hassle.

1. Preparation: Gather the necessary tools, including a screwdriver, wire strippers, and electrical tape, and ensure the power is turned off at the circuit breaker.
2. Wiring the Device: Connect the Smart Implant to the existing electrical circuit by following the wiring diagrams provided in the installation manual. Proper wiring is essential to prevent any electrical issues.
3. Positioning: Choose a discreet yet accessible location for installation. The Smart Implant should be placed where it can easily connect to other smart devices without interference.
4. Powering Up: Once installed, restore power and test the device to ensure it is functioning correctly. This includes confirming connectivity to the Z-Wave network and testing the inputs and outputs.
5. Configuration: Use the Fibaro app or a compatible home automation platform to configure the Smart Implant’s settings and integrate it with other devices as needed.

By following these steps, homeowners can successfully integrate the Fibaro Smart Implant into their smart home ecosystem, enhancing both functionality and comfort.
